Changeset View
Changeset View
Standalone View
Standalone View
source/blender/nodes/composite/nodes/node_composite_moviedistortion.c
| Show First 20 Lines • Show All 58 Lines • ▼ Show 20 Lines | |||||
| { | { | ||||
| if (node->storage) { | if (node->storage) { | ||||
| BKE_tracking_distortion_free(node->storage); | BKE_tracking_distortion_free(node->storage); | ||||
| } | } | ||||
| node->storage = NULL; | node->storage = NULL; | ||||
| } | } | ||||
| static void storage_copy(bNodeTree *UNUSED(dest_ntree), bNode *dest_node, bNode *src_node) | static void storage_copy(bNodeTree *UNUSED(dest_ntree), bNode *dest_node, const bNode *src_node) | ||||
| { | { | ||||
| if (src_node->storage) { | if (src_node->storage) { | ||||
| dest_node->storage = BKE_tracking_distortion_copy(src_node->storage); | dest_node->storage = BKE_tracking_distortion_copy(src_node->storage); | ||||
| } | } | ||||
| } | } | ||||
| void register_node_type_cmp_moviedistortion(void) | void register_node_type_cmp_moviedistortion(void) | ||||
| { | { | ||||
| Show All 11 Lines | |||||